Freecell Solitaire Free centers on precise mouse or touch interactions to organize a standard deck of cards. Unlike other solitaire variants, this version displays all cards face-up from the start, shifting the focus from luck to pure logical deduction. You interact with the tableau by selecting and moving cards between columns, utilizing four open cells as temporary storage. These cells are the core mechanic, allowing you to hold single cards while you rearrange the main stacks to reveal the sequences you need.

Success depends on your ability to sequence cards in descending order and alternating colors within the main columns. The timing of when to use an open cell and when to clear it is the primary challenge. Because every card is visible, you can plan several moves ahead, calculating how to free up an Ace or a low-value card trapped deep within a column. The goal is to move all cards into the four foundation piles, organized by suit from Ace to King.

How to Play

Start by examining the eight columns of face-up cards. Your goal is to move all cards to the four foundation piles located at the top of the screen. Each foundation pile must be built by suit, starting with the Ace and continuing in ascending order to the King. Use your mouse or touch screen to select a card and move it to another column or an open cell.

In the main columns, you can only place a card on another card if it is one rank lower and of the opposite color. For example, a red 6 can only be placed on a black 7. If you have an empty column, you can move any card or valid sequence into that space. The four open cells at the top can each hold one single card at a time, giving you the room needed to reach cards buried deep in the stacks.

Plan your moves carefully, as the number of cards you can move at once is often limited by the number of empty open cells and empty columns you have available. Clear the board by systematically moving cards to the foundations.

Tips & Tricks

  1. Keep as many open cells empty as possible to maintain movement flexibility.
  2. Prioritize moving Aces to the foundation piles early in the session.
  3. Look for long sequences of alternating colors to clear columns quickly.
  4. Use the open cells only when a card is blocking a vital move.
